Louisiana courts prioritize the best interest of the child, considering factors such as parental involvement, stability, and the child's relationship with each parent. Custody arrangements can be agreed upon by both parties or decided by a judge if agreement is not possible.

Louisiana uses a formula based on both parents' incomes, the number of children, and custody arrangements. Courts may adjust amounts based on special needs, medical expenses, or other relevant factors.
